The signed movement is protected by an inner hinged cover upon which is some beautiful engraving… “Presented to Mr D M Davies, By the Staff & Workmen of NF Factory No 18, Pembrey, 30th Jan 1920”, this possibly relates to the munitions factories which were on the site.

The watch itself measures 50mm diameter excluding the winding stem and the loop. The case is gold plated and is the Moon model by the Dennison Watch Case Company. The Moon model was a good quality 10ct gold plated case originally guaranteed to wear for 20 years. Aaron Lufkin Dennison pioneered watchmaking in America before moving to England in 1862 to set up a watch case factory in the Handsworth area of Birmingham.
